Answer:
c = 15 meters
Step-by-step explanation:
This is solveable using the Pythagorean Theorem,
let's say a = 9 and b = 12,
a^2 + b^2 = c^2, so
9^2 + 12^2 = 225 then,
sqrt(225) = 15, so c = 15 m

Answer:
x=65
other angle= 165
Step-by-step explanation:
quadrilaterals always have a total of 360 degrees
because of this you can set up an equation and solve
360=90+40+x+(4x-95)
360=130+5x-95
360=35+5x
325=5x
65=x
plug this in to find missing angle
4(65)-95=165
